Termites extermination services involve the identification and eradication of termite infestations within a property. Professionals typically conduct thorough inspections to locate active colonies and assess the extent of damage caused by these pests. Treatment methods may include the application of liquid termiticides, baiting systems, or other targeted solutions designed to eliminate termites at their source. The goal is to prevent ongoing damage and protect the structural integrity of the property.

Termite problems can lead to significant structural damage if left untreated, often compromising wood frameworks, flooring, and drywall. Over time, infestations may result in costly repairs and decreased property value. Termites are usually hidden within walls, foundations, or underground, making professional detection essential. Extermination services help address these hidden threats by removing colonies and implementing preventative measures to reduce the risk of future invasions.

Initial Treatment Costs - The cost for a one-time termite treatment typically ranges from $500 to $1,200, depending on the extent of infestation and property size. For example, a standard home in Plano might see prices around $750. These costs cover liquid treatments or baiting systems installed by local service providers.

Monthly Monitoring Expenses - Ongoing termite monitoring services usually cost between $40 and $70 per month. This fee includes regular inspections and maintenance of bait stations to prevent future infestations. Prices can vary based on property size and service frequency.

Whole-Home Treatment Estimates - Complete termite extermination for larger or heavily infested homes can range from $1,500 to $3,500. This often involves extensive treatments and multiple visits by local pros to ensure complete eradication. Costs depend on the home's square footage and severity of damage.

Inspection Fees - Professional termite inspections typically cost between $75 and $150. Some service providers include the inspection fee in the cost of treatment, while others charge separately. Inspections help identify the extent of the problem and inform treatment options.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do termite extermination services work? Termite extermination services typically involve inspecting the property, identifying termite activity, and applying targeted treatments such as liquid barriers or bait systems to eliminate colonies.

Are treatments safe for my family and pets? Most termite treatments are designed to be safe when applied by professionals, but it's recommended to follow any specific safety instructions provided by the service provider.

How long does a termite treatment usually last? The duration of effectiveness varies depending on the treatment method used, but many treatments provide protection for several years with proper maintenance.

Can I stay in my home during termite treatment? In many cases, residents can remain in their homes during treatments, though some procedures may require temporary vacating; it’s best to consult with the service provider for specific guidance.

How do I know if I have a termite problem? Signs of termites include discarded wings, mud tubes on walls or foundation, and visible damage to wood structures; a professional inspection can confirm an infestation.
